About This Item
Introduction by Jeff Kaliss. Essay by Gene Lees. 86 pages, captioned b/w photos pages 36-86. Cloth boards in dust-jacket. Lee Tanner examines Dizzy Gillespie's career from the 1940s to the 1990s. The book combines a rich assemblage of photographs by a variety of renowned jazz photographers with memorable quotations both by and about Dizzy.
